Hey guys, I'm troubleshooting an error on the mini split.
Its an LAU096HV outside unit.
The inside unit was replaced last year due to a leaking evaporator coil.
Now I am getting a electronic error.
The system will run for several hours and then kick off. Its cooling, its doing its thing, but it seems to be worse the colder it is outside.
The screen says C6. That translates to:
LG AC Fault Definition = Excessive current at inverter DC power circuit – DC Peak Power
The board (6871A10135Y) says it was manufactured in 2009. The caps are all on the board. There are 3 about the size of a D cell battery. The board looks good, brand new even. Everything in the outside unit looks good, no obviously bad caps or whatever.
The only thing that looks funny to me is the thermistor on the bottom of the AC unit and its covered in green corrosion at the tip.
